Hasbro, Inc.'s dividend schedule

Hasbro, Inc. has paid quarterly across the 39 years of records we hold, with the most recent ex-date on August 19, 2026. Its ex-dates usually land in the last third of the month.

Payment follows the ex-date by about 16 days, based on the announcements we hold for HAS.

Increases have a season: of the 16 raises in our record, most take effect with the April payment, so that is the ex-date to watch for a change in the amount.

Frequently asked questions

Do I need to own HAS before the ex-dividend date?
Yes. You must already hold the shares when trading opens on the ex-dividend date to receive the payment. Buying on the ex-date itself is too late — the seller keeps that dividend. See ex-date vs record date vs payment date for how the dates fit together.
